Organizations often face the challenge of moving their existing databases to advanced platforms that offer better scalability and flexibility. One such transformation involves transitioning from a traditional system to a modern, cloud-based solution. The process may seem daunting, but with a systematic approach, the shift can be smooth. This transformation allows businesses to leverage improved performance, cost-efficiency, and advanced analytics capabilities.
A well-planned transition ensures continuity and positions organizations for future growth. Addressing potential challenges in advance further streamlines the overall process. This article outlines essential steps for a seamless Oracle to Snowflake migration while maintaining the integrity of your information.
Develop and prioritize a comprehensive migration strategy
A robust strategy is the keystone of any successful transition. Begin by evaluating the scope and requirements of the transfer. Identifying the critical elements of your existing environment and determining what must be preserved is essential. Collaborating with stakeholders to define objectives helps create a roadmap modified to your specific needs.
Effective prioritization ensures that sensitive or high-impact workloads are handled with utmost care. Plan each phase to include testing periods to minimize disruptions during implementation. Adopting a phased approach can also help identify potential issues early and address them promptly. This strategy minimizes risks and ensures that the shift aligns with organizational goals.
Detailed project timelines, resource allocation, and communication plans are essential components of the overall strategy. Defining clear responsibilities for each team member allows for seamless collaboration. When everyone understands their role, the entire process becomes more efficient and manageable.
Move data as-is through a lift-and-shift approach
A lift-and-shift method is often considered the fastest way to transport information. This approach involves transferring datasets to the new platform without modifying their structure. While this may not initially leverage all features of the destination system, it ensures compatibility and stability. To optimize Oracle to Snowflake migration tools used in this approach, organizations can leverage automated tools that facilitate a smooth transition without the need for extensive manual intervention.
This strategy is ideal for organizations that need to meet tight deadlines or reduce downtime during the shift. However, it’s important to recognize that the lift-and-shift technique is only the first step. Once the transfer is complete, optimization efforts can follow, allowing the system to take full advantage of the advanced functionalities offered by the new platform. In some cases, this approach works best as a foundation for further refinement. Once all the information is securely moved, teams can focus on restructuring, fine-tuning, and unlocking the potential of the new system’s capabilities.
Create detailed documentation of your migration plan and actions
Documentation is a vital component of any major IT project. A well-documented plan acts as a guide and ensures that all team members are on the same page. During the shift, recording the specifics of each action, including configurations and adjustments, provides a reliable reference for troubleshooting. Following Oracle to Snowflake migration best practices makes it easy to maintain detailed documentation, ensure consistency, and help lessen errors throughout the transition.
High-quality documentation proves invaluable for long-term maintenance as well. It helps onboard new team members and ensures that future changes or upgrades are carried out smoothly. Focus on creating a comprehensive yet accessible record that includes diagrams, workflow descriptions, and explanatory notes.
Detailed documentation should include pre-migration evaluations, technical requirements, and a clear map of dependencies. Organizing information in an easy-to-understand format reduces confusion and prepares your organization for any unforeseen challenges.
Implement automated validation to ensure consistency between Oracle and Snowflake
Maintaining accuracy during the migration is crucial, especially when transitioning from Oracle to Snowflake. Automated validation tools are extremely necessary to ensure that data is transferred seamlessly and accurately between the two platforms. These tools help reduce common Oracle to Snowflake migration challenges, such as data inconsistencies or mismatches, by automatically validating records and ensuring they align with the required formats.
Here are some key benefits of using automated validation:
- Streamlined processes that reduce manual errors
- Faster identification of mismatched records
- Enhanced confidence in the reliability of transferred datasets
Investing in robust validation tools saves time and reduces the risks associated with incorrect or incomplete transfers. The consistency achieved through automation ensures that business operations remain unaffected throughout the process. By deploying scripts or pre-built automation frameworks, teams can continuously monitor and compare datasets. Furthermore, these tools can validate formatting, data types, and dependencies to ensure the new system matches the operational standards of the previous environment. This process lays a strong foundation for post-migration analysis and optimization.
Why Use Hevo Data
When choosing tools to facilitate the transition, platforms like Hevo Data can provide unparalleled ease of use. Hevo offers no-code solutions that simplify the process for teams with varying technical expertise. Its pre-built integrations allow quick connectivity between legacy systems and the cloud.
Additionally, Hevo ensures real-time data streaming, reducing latency in critical operations. With features designed for scalability, the platform supports both small-scale projects and enterprise-level shifts. As a comprehensive solution, it eliminates many of the common obstacles encountered during major IT upgrades.
Hevo’s reliability also stems from its robust customer support and training resources. Users can leverage these resources to understand the platform better, troubleshoot issues, and accelerate the migration process. Its adaptability to diverse use cases makes it a valuable tool for organizations aiming to modernize their information systems.
Conclusion
Transitioning to a cloud-based system is an investment in scalability and innovation. By following a structured plan, leveraging automation, and utilizing effective tools, organizations can achieve a smooth Oracle to Snowflake migration. Proper planning, thorough documentation, and reliable tools like Hevo Data ensure consistency, accuracy, and long-term success.

